1
0
mirror of synced 2024-12-05 04:27:56 +01:00
ImHex/plugins/builtin/include/content/command_line_interface.hpp
2023-12-05 16:45:35 +01:00

25 lines
880 B
C++

#pragma once
#include <string>
#include <vector>
namespace hex::plugin::builtin {
void handleVersionCommand(const std::vector<std::string> &args);
void handleHelpCommand(const std::vector<std::string> &args);
void handlePluginsCommand(const std::vector<std::string> &args);
void handleOpenCommand(const std::vector<std::string> &args);
void handleCalcCommand(const std::vector<std::string> &args);
void handleHashCommand(const std::vector<std::string> &args);
void handleEncodeCommand(const std::vector<std::string> &args);
void handleDecodeCommand(const std::vector<std::string> &args);
void handleMagicCommand(const std::vector<std::string> &args);
void handlePatternLanguageCommand(const std::vector<std::string> &args);
void handleHexdumpCommand(const std::vector<std::string> &args);
void registerCommandForwarders();
}